This is my second attempt to post a couple questions. I'm in the process of repairing a rotten transom on my 17.5 ft aluminum boat. I was hoping to remove in one piece but it was so punky the lower portion came out in shreds. I was able to remove the thru hull screws in the center well of the boat but on either side the battery compartment blocks access and it is all enclosed in aluminum that is heavily riveted into splash well above and the sides. I'm contenplating using a hole saw to drill a hole on the back side of each side battery compartment to access the nuts of the screws that i can't get to that come thru the transom sandwiching the plywood in place. Any ideas are welcomed. Also there are three 1" aluminum tubes that go from splash well thru transom, two are to drain splash well and one is for transducer cables. These tubes are roll crimped to aluminum skin on each side of transom. My question is do i need to remove, if so how do i replace? Or do i slot new transom material to go around these tubes? The drain tubes will NEED to come out. Use a chisel to knock down the lip on the inside and then tap them out. You can buy replacements right here in the iBoats store. Here's a drawing on how to make your own installation tool or you can buy one for 40 bucks or you might be able to borrow one from a local marina.

The hole saw will probably work for the nuts, you can patch them over after reinstalling the nuts and bolts after the new wood goes in.

The thru transom sleeves need to be removed then redrill the holes through the new wood and install new sleeves. Notching around them isn't an option.
